Newcastle United have signed midfielder Miguel Almiron from Atlanta United in a club-record deal, the Premier League side have confirmed.The Paraguay international has joined the Magpiesafter they had an offer worth roughly 20.6million ($27million) accepted by the MLS outfit.Almiron was instrumental for his side as they won the MLS Cup last season, scoring 13 goals and assisting a further 11 as his side were crowned champions of the United States’ top league.The fee for Almiron, 24, has surpassed the 16million Newcastle paid for Michael Owen in 2005 to make him the most expensive player in the club’s history.

REVEALED: When every Premier League and Championship club last broke their transfer record


Rafa Benitez has been looking for a number ten throughout his time in charge St James Park, and Almiron’s arrival finally provides him with the type of player he has craved throughout that time.And he will appeal to Benitez for his versatility as he can play on either wing or in the No.10 role behind the striker.He possesses a great knack for getting goals but is also a fantastic creator of chances, while he has been praised for his excellent work rate in both attack and defence.Almiron won the MLS Cup with Atlanta United last month1

Almiron has been capped13 times for the Paraguay national team but is yet to score for his country.“Im very happy and eager to start and to meet my new team mates,” Almiron said. “The league is very competitive, this is a historic club, andRafa Benitezhimself were the main reasons why I am here now.“I think it is a great responsibility, something beautiful for me, and I will try to offer the best I can to repay the trust the club put in me.” Benitez added: “We were following Miguel Almirn for a while, and we saw a player with some pace in attack, who can play behind the striker. We have someone who can score goals and give assists.“We know that MLS is a different challenge to the Premier League but he has the potential to do what we are expecting, and what we need.“From talking to the lad, you can tell that he is really focussed and wants to do well. He wants to be successful and he wants to help the team, to score goals and give assists if it is possible.“His impact in MLS has been really good – he’s been one of the best players this year – and hopefully he can give us more competition and more quality in the final third.“I am pleased that the hard work behind the scenes has ended positively and I thank everyone for their efforts.”On Wednesday the player said his goodbyes at Atlanta United on a social media post.He posteda selection of images from his time with the MLS side on his Instagram page before travelling to the UK, with the caption: Thanks Atlanta for all the love. I love you so much.Newcastle’s newest recruit could make his debut on Saturday afternoon as the Magpies face Tottenham in the Premier League.He was the second new arrival at St James’ Park on deadline day, with Newcastle also doing a deal forAntonio Barreca.The 23-year-old defender has joined the Magpies on loan for the rest of the season, with thePremier Leagueclub having an option to complete a permanent deal in the summer.

Wigan Athletic's five-match unbeaten run came to an end as two second-half goals secured play-off chasing Derby County all three points at Pride Park on Tuesday evening. Latics had taken a first-half lead through Gavin Massey but a wonder goal from Mason Bennett levelled the game before Scott Malone scored a late winner for the Rams.
